The City of Port Moody invites you to find your creative place indoors, outdoors, or online as we celebrate Culture Days over four weeks from September 25 to October 25, 2020. The idea behind Culture Days is to offer free, hands-on activities that encourage the public to go behind the scenes and discover the world of arts and culture.

We still have 39 days until summer officially ends, so get outside and make the most of it – but please be a good neighbour when using parks, trails, and other public spaces. Being a good neighbour means showing respect for others and for our natural environment, and continuing to do our part to help prevent the spread of COVID-19.
